方法一:jsonp函数 在HTML DOM中,Script标签是可以跨域访问服务器上的数据的.因此,可以指定script的src属性为跨域的url,基于script标签实现跨域.script标签本身就可以访问其它域的资源,不受浏览器同源策略的限制,可以通过在页面动态创建script标签。 这样通过动 ...
分类:
Web程序 时间:
2019-05-08 09:15:47
阅读次数:
177
jsonp的本质是通过script标签的src属性请求到服务端,拿到到服务端返回的数据 ,因为src是可以跨域的。前端通过src发送跨域请求时在请求的url带上回调函数,服务端收到请求时,接受前端传过来的回掉函数名称,将其拼接成js函数调用返回到前端即可完成跨域请求。 前端实现代码: .Net服务端 ...
分类:
Web程序 时间:
2019-05-05 23:22:07
阅读次数:
193
1. 介绍:nginx是一个高性能的http和反向代理服务器,也是一个通用的TCP/UDP代理服务器。 2. 应用中作用: A. 正向代理(为客户端服务)和反向代理(为服务端服务); B. 解决跨域; C. 请求过滤; D. 负载均衡:用来将众多的客户端请求合理的分配到各个服务器,以达到服务器资源的 ...
分类:
Web程序 时间:
2019-05-04 14:59:26
阅读次数:
406
Django 报错,跨域请求出现问题。 在settings.py中添加 #设置可跨域范围 CORS_ALLOW_CREDENTIALS = True CORS_ORIGIN_ALLOW_ALL = True #定义跨域中间件 'corsheaders.middleware.CorsMiddlewar ...
分类:
数据库 时间:
2019-05-04 00:31:24
阅读次数:
19856
location ~ .*\.(gif|jpg|jpeg|png|bmp|swf|flv|mp4|ico)$ { #允许跨域请求 add_header Access-Control-Allow-Origin '*'; add_header Access-Control-Allow-Headers X... ...
分类:
Web程序 时间:
2019-04-30 12:20:20
阅读次数:
1079
Angular4.x请求 码云地址: https://gitee.com/ccsoftlucifer/Angular4Study 1. 搭建工程 新建一个工程angulardemo03 ng new angulardemo03 npm install 更新依赖 2. 新建组件 在app目录新建文件夹 ...
分类:
其他好文 时间:
2019-04-29 12:19:34
阅读次数:
102
项目背景:我们有web和大屏,以及移动端,需要访问微服务接口。 然而大屏时自己打开的网页,在网页中通过js调用我的webapi。出现了跨域情况。 原因:出现这个问题,是由于跨域请求有2次请求。 第一次:options(查看请求可用性,确定请求后端是否支持请求类型) 第二次:才是你的真实请求。(get ...
分类:
编程语言 时间:
2019-04-28 12:40:40
阅读次数:
209
JSONP JSONP(JSONP - JSON with Padding是JSON的一种“使用模式”),利用script标签的src属性(浏览器允许script标签跨域) JSONP的产生 1、一个众所周知的问题,Ajax直接请求普通文件存在跨域无权限访问的问题,甭管你是静态页面、动态网页、web ...
分类:
Web程序 时间:
2019-04-26 21:01:52
阅读次数:
151
1. 什么是前后端分离开发的概念: 前端页面运行前端服务器上,负责页面的渲染(静态文件的加载)与跳转 后端代码运行在后端服务器上, 负责数据的处理(提供数据请求的接口) 2. 前后端分离开发碰到的问题 那就是跨域请求的问题: 3. 处理跨域的问题: 安装django-cors-headers模块 在 ...
分类:
其他好文 时间:
2019-04-26 14:58:18
阅读次数:
171
跨域实现的过程大致如下: 1 从 http://www.a.com/test.html 发起一个跨域请求, 请求的地址为: http://www.b.com/test.php 2 如果 服务器B返回一个如下的header Access-Control-Allow-Origin: http://www ...
分类:
其他好文 时间:
2019-04-23 12:28:11
阅读次数:
277